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om East Lake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in East Lake with 3 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in East Lake is at Summit East Ridge listed at $1,260.

How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om East Lake Apartment?

The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in East Lake is $1,574.

What is the largest available 3 Bedroom East Lake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in East Lake is a 1,325 square feet unit starting from $1,401 at The Reserve at Mountain Pass.

What is the average size for East Lake 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in East Lake is currently 1,387 sq ft.
